THE BLACK NORKS OF ERITREA
Asmara, Eritrea. I came here to see if the rumor is true, that Eritrea is the North Korea of Africa.
Strategically situated at the entrance to Red Sea, it's ruled by Isaias Afewerki (ah-for-key), ranked by international agencies as one of the world's worst dictators, in the same league as Robert Mugabe, Kim Jong-il, and the Castro brothers.
The Heritage Foundation's Index of World Freedom ranks Eritrea #176 out of 179 countries. Transparency International's Index of Corruption ranks it as one of the world's most corrupt countries. Reporters Without Borders' Press Freedom Index ranks it as having the least press freedom on earth along with North Korea.
There are a number of exile opposition groups, in Europe, the US, and elsewhere in Africa that are clamoring and hoping for a Tunis or Cairo in Asmara - a popular revolution that will do to Afewerki what happened to Ben Ali and Mubarak.
